Coinbase API是Coinbase交易所提供的一组接口,用于与Coinbase平台进行交互和数据传输。通过使用Coinbase API,开发者可以创建自己的应用程序,实现与Coinbase交易所的集成,以便进行交易、查询账户信息、获取市场数据等操作。
Coinbase API可以分为以下几个主要类别:
- 身份验证和授权:Coinbase API提供了身份验证和授权机制,开发者可以通过OAuth 2.0协议进行用户身份验证,并获取访问令牌(access token)来访问用户的账户信息和执行交易操作。
- 账户管理:通过Coinbase API,开发者可以查询用户的账户余额、交易历史、持仓信息等。还可以创建新的钱包地址、发送和接收加密货币等。
- 交易操作:Coinbase API允许开发者执行买入、卖出、转账等交易操作。开发者可以根据市场价格进行交易,并获取交易的状态和详细信息。
- 市场数据:通过Coinbase API,开发者可以获取加密货币的实时市场数据,包括价格、成交量、交易对等。这些数据可以用于开发行情监控、交易策略等应用。
- 通知和事件:Coinbase API提供了通知和事件机制,开发者可以订阅特定事件的通知,如交易完成、账户余额变动等。这样可以实时获取与用户账户相关的信息。
Coinbase API的优势包括:
- 简单易用:Coinbase API提供了简洁的接口和详细的文档,使开发者能够快速上手并进行开发。
- 安全可靠:Coinbase是一家知名的加密货币交易所,其API采用了安全的身份验证和授权机制,保证了用户数据的安全性。
- 全球覆盖:Coinbase交易所支持多个国家和地区,因此Coinbase API可以满足全球范围内的开发需求。
Coinbase API的应用场景包括:
- 加密货币交易应用:开发者可以利用Coinbase API构建自己的加密货币交易平台,实现买卖加密货币的功能。
- 钱包应用:通过Coinbase API,开发者可以创建和管理加密货币钱包,实现发送、接收加密货币的功能。
- 市场数据分析:利用Coinbase API提供的市场数据,开发者可以进行加密货币市场的数据分析和趋势预测。
腾讯云相关产品和产品介绍链接地址:
腾讯云提供了一系列云计算相关的产品和服务,以下是一些与Coinbase API相关的腾讯云产品:
- 云服务器(ECS):腾讯云的云服务器提供了高性能、可扩展的计算资源,可以用于部署和运行Coinbase API应用程序。产品介绍链接:https://cloud.tencent.com/product/cvm
- 云数据库MySQL版:腾讯云的云数据库MySQL版提供了可靠的、高性能的MySQL数据库服务,可以用于存储和管理与Coinbase API相关的数据。产品介绍链接:https://cloud.tencent.com/product/cdb_mysql
- 云存储(COS):腾讯云的云存储服务提供了安全可靠的对象存储服务,可以用于存储Coinbase API应用程序中的文件和数据。产品介绍链接:https://cloud.tencent.com/product/cos
请注意,以上只是一些腾讯云的产品示例,实际上腾讯云提供了更多与云计算相关的产品和服务,可以根据具体需求选择适合的产品。